Common Zod Schemas
// Email
z.string().email("Invalid email address")
// Required string with min length
z.string().min(2, "Must be at least 2 characters")
// Optional string
z.string().optional()
// Number with range
z.number().min(0).max(100)
// URL
z.string().url("Invalid URL")
// Password (min 8 chars)
z.string().min(8, "Password must be at least 8 characters")
// Confirm password match
z.object({
password: z.string().min(8),
confirmPassword: z.string(),
}).refine((data) => data.password === data.confirmPassword, {
message: "Passwords don't match",
path: ["confirmPassword"],
})
// Array with min items
z.array(z.string()).min(1, "At least one item required")
// Enum
z.enum(["option1", "option2"], {
errorMap: () => ({ message: "Invalid option" }),
})

Form Validation Patterns
Conditional Validation
const schema = z.object({
hasAccount: z.boolean(),
email: z.string().optional(),
}).refine((data) => {
if (data.hasAccount) {
return data.email && z.string().email().safeParse(data.email).success;
}
return true;
}, {
message: "Email is required when account is selected",
path: ["email"],
});
Async Validation
const schema = z.object({
username: z.string().refine(async (username) => {
const { data } = await supabase
.from("users")
.select("id")
.eq("username", username)
.single();
return !data; // Username available if no data
}, {
message: "Username already taken",
}),
});
Best Practices
- Always use zodResolver - Type-safe validation
- Define schema first - Then infer TypeScript types
- Use FormField component - Provides proper error handling
- Handle loading states - Disable submit button during submission
- Display root errors - Show general form errors
- Use FormDescription - Help users understand fields
- Follow brand guidelines - Use
brand-gradientfor submit buttons - Mobile-friendly - Ensure inputs are at least 44px tall
Common Mistakes to Avoid
❌ Not using zodResolver - loses type safety ❌ Inline validation - use zod schemas instead ❌ Missing error handling - always handle submission errors ❌ No loading states - users don't know if form is submitting ❌ Skipping FormMessage - errors won't display properly ❌ Not following brand colors - use brand-gradient for buttons
